The Boston Civic Symphony will present our last classical concert of its 99th season on Sunday, May 12, 2024 at 3:00 p.m., at New England Conservatory’s Jordan Hall in Boston. Francisco Noya will start the program with Azul by Osvaldo Golijov with our soloist Allison Eldredge. Experience this beautiful piece with the fantastic acoustics of Jordan Hall. Following Azul we will perform Florence Price’s Andante Moderato from String Quartet no. 1, and finally we will end with Pines of Rome by Respighi. A monumental piece.
